Insulated Electrical Wire Crimper Market Trends and Forecast
The future of the global insulated electrical wire crimper market looks promising with opportunities in the automobile, construction, and electric power markets. The global insulated electrical wire crimper market is expected to reach an estimated $10.6 billion by 2035 with a CAGR of 6% from 2026 to 2035. The major drivers for this market are the increasing demand for electrical safety standards, the rising need for efficient wiring solutions, and the growing adoption of automation in industries.
• Lucintel forecasts that, within the type category, welding is expected to witness higher growth over the forecast period.
• Within the application category, automobile is expected to witness the highest growth.
• In terms of region, APAC is expected to witness the highest growth over the forecast period.

The challenges facing this insulated electrical wire crimper market include:
• Fluctuating Raw Material Costs: The market heavily depends on raw materials such as copper, aluminum, and specialized plastics, which are subject to price volatility due to geopolitical tensions, supply chain disruptions, and market speculation. Rising raw material costs increase manufacturing expenses, potentially leading to higher product prices and reduced competitiveness. Manufacturers may face pressure to absorb costs or pass them onto consumers, which can impact profit margins. Additionally, supply shortages can delay production schedules, affecting market supply and customer satisfaction. Managing procurement strategies and diversifying supply sources are critical to mitigating this challenge.
• Stringent Safety and Environmental Regulations: While regulations promote safety and environmental sustainability, they also impose significant compliance costs on manufacturers. Developing insulated crimpers that meet evolving standards requires substantial R&D investment, certification processes, and quality assurance measures. Non-compliance can result in legal penalties, product recalls, and damage to brand reputation. Smaller players may struggle to keep pace with regulatory changes, leading to market consolidation. Navigating complex regulatory landscapes demands continuous monitoring and adaptation, which can slow innovation and increase operational costs, posing a challenge to market growth.
• Technological Obsolescence and Innovation Pace: Rapid technological advancements can render existing crimping tools obsolete, forcing manufacturers to continually innovate. Keeping up with the latest features, materials, and safety standards requires significant investment in R&D. Failure to innovate may result in loss of market share to competitors offering more advanced solutions. Additionally, integrating new technologies such as automation and smart features can be complex and costly. The risk of investing in technologies that may quickly become outdated necessitates strategic planning and agility, which can be challenging for companies with limited resources.
